Seite 1 von 2

"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 09:33
von Gumfuzi
Hallo!

ich habe seit einiger Zeit eine neue Config am laufen, welche aber beim Starten manchmal sofort abstürzt.
Im Unterschied zu früher habe ich den PageScraper in der Dateiversion 2.5.4.0 am laufen.

Kann es sein, dass dieser rumzickt? Hat jemand ähnliche Probleme gehabt?

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 10:38
von Schnuffel
Hallo Gumfuzi,

also wenn die Config.exe nicht mehr funktioniert weiss ich nicht weiter.

Wenn aber - und ich hoffe, wir beide meinen das gleiche - die Samu-cfg direkt bei deren Start abschmiert, dann werden meisstens zu viele Dinge auf einmal beim Starten erledigt/abgefragt. Gerade Pagescraper-lastige .inis neigen dazu. Das hat nichts mit der Prozessorauslastung zu tun, Samurize ist dann wohl einfach überfordert.

Um das Problem zu vermeiden habe ich weitestgehend alle meine .inis versucht zu "optimieren", d.h. nur jeweils ein PS pro .ini. Grosse .inis habe ich in mehrere kleine aufgetrennt. Darüber hinaus starte ich alle cfgs per Script versetzt zeitverzögert (je nach Mächtigkeit zw. 1-15 sec).
Seit dem klappts problemlos mit dem Starten, selbst bei >30 cfgs. :)

BTW: PS v3.0.2.0 arbeitet hier. Bei Bedarf müsste ich in den Datenkeller, das Orginalarchiv suchen.

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 10:56
von moinmoin
Da isser http://www.deskmodder.de/phpBB3/viewtop ... 71&t=12074

Wenns trotzdem abstürzt meld dich noch mal ;)

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 12:04
von Gumfuzi
danke für die Info, ja es sind 8 PS-Abfragen.

Werde mal die 3er Version testen. Die Verzögerung, stelle ich die direkt im PS ein? oder in Samu selbst?

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 12:33
von Schnuffel
Gumfuzi hat geschrieben:Die Verzögerung, stelle ich die direkt im PS ein? oder in Samu selbst?
Ich benutze ein Kommandozeilen-Tool dafür, HStart (Freeware) -> http://www.ntwind.com/software/hstart.html

So wirds gemacht:
Erstelle eine mit einem Texteditor eine Batch-Datei, die Du z.B. "Autostart_Samurize.cmd" nennst. Die einzelnen Parameter für HStart sind erklärt, /DELAY=n fügt eine Pause von n Sekunden beim Ablauf der Batch ein.
Bei mir schauts z.B. so aus:

Code: Alles auswählen

...
C:\Programme\HStart\hstart.exe /NOCONSOLE /DELAY=7 "C:\Programme\Samurize\Client.exe i=NeuerRegen c=NeuerRegen.ini"
C:\Programme\HStart\hstart.exe /NOCONSOLE /DELAY=1 "C:\Programme\Samurize\Client.exe i=RotatorTemperatur c=RotatorTemperatur.ini"
C:\Programme\HStart\hstart.exe /NOCONSOLE /DELAY=7 "C:\Programme\Samurize\Client.exe i=AxTV_ZDFneo c=AxTv_ZDFneo.ini"
...
Diese Batchdatei rufst du dann mit folgendem Kommando aus deinem bevorzugtem Programmstarter auf:

Code: Alles auswählen

C:\Programme\HStart\hstart.exe /NOCONSOLE "Autostart_Samurize.cmd"
HStart unterbindet dann die Ausgabe des Kommandozeilenfensters komplett :)

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 15:01
von Gumfuzi
Achso meinst du das, mit Batch-Dateien - die möchte ich gerne vermeiden.

Aus den 8 könnte ich 2 PS-Abfragen machen, da die 8 Dinge in 2 Seiten stehen - ev. habe ich dann auch weniger Probleme.

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 15:25
von moinmoin
In den Optionen kannst du einstellen wie häufig PS abfragen soll.
Dementsprechend kannst du unter Projekt Optionen im Editor den Regler auch höher stellen.

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 15:38
von Schnuffel
Das ist schon richtig, hilft aber Gumfuzi beim Startproblem der cfg nicht wirklich.
Bei dem Start werden alle enthaltenen PS einmalig sofort ausgeführt, erst danach greift deine Idee mit den unterschiedlichen Updateintervallen. Denn beim Start semmelt Samu ja ab...

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 15:52
von Gumfuzi
So isses.

habe nun die 3er Version in den Pluginordner gegeben, seit dem schreibt er mir (zusätzlich zu dem manchmal auftretenden, obigen Fehler) hin:
Zwischenablage01.jpg
Meint er die Suchtags oder irgendwelche Tags in irgendwelcher Config-datei?

btw: ich habe aktuell auch probiert, die 2 Dateien nur 1x zu laden und sie dann lokal zu speichern und per Pagescraper auszulesen. Aber da ich dies lokal auch via Pagescraper mache, wird wohl deswegen die Client.exe wieder abschmieren beim Start.

Wenn ich die beiden Dateien per Pagescraper auslese und lokal speichere (als ini) und diese dann mit ReadINI.dll auslese, dann habe ich nur mehr 2x den PS in Verwendung, was hoffentlich klappen sollte - mal testen...

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 16:26
von Gumfuzi
mit nur 2 Aufrufe des PS schmiert mir nun die client.exe nicht mehr ab (sind in einer INI), aber der Fehler mit den Tags kommt immer noch. Ansonsten passt alles und es wird auch alles richtig ausgelesen.

Hier der Abschnitt meiner Config (die xxxxx sind natürlich nur Platzhalter):

Code: Alles auswählen

[Meter 56]
Name=Copy 8 of Meter 49
Group=
Locking=0

[Source 56]
Type=TActiveDLLCollector
DLLName=PageScraper.dll
DLLFunction=GetWebpage
PageScraper_Webpage="http://www.xxxxx.com/xxxxx/xxxxx.txt"
PageScraper_PageScraperName="PageScraper1"
PageScraper_Seconds=6000
PageScraper_SaveINIFile=1
PageScraper_SaveINIFilename="%SAMDIR%\plugins\PageScraper\gumfuzi_bc.ini"
PageScraper_SaveTMPFilename="%SAMDIR%\plugins\PageScraper\.tmp"
PageScraper_MatchData1="Match:1","MatchName:Match1","MatchStart:Datenbank: ","MatchEnd:WWW","OccurRangeBegin:1","ModifyEnabled1:1","ModifyType1:RightTrim","ModifyFirstStr1:%b"
PageScraper_MatchData2="Match:1","MatchName:Match2","MatchStart:WWW: ","OccurRangeBegin:1","ModifyEnabled1:1","ModifyType1:Filter"
PageScraper_MatchData3="MatchName:Match3","OccurRangeBegin:1"
PageScraper_MatchData4="MatchName:Match4","OccurRangeBegin:1"
PageScraper_MatchData5="MatchName:Match5","OccurRangeBegin:1"
PageScraper_MatchData6="MatchName:Match6","OccurRangeBegin:1"
PageScraper_MatchData7="MatchName:Match7","OccurRangeBegin:1"
PageScraper_MatchData8="MatchName:Match8","OccurRangeBegin:1"
PageScraper_MatchData9="MatchName:Match9","OccurRangeBegin:1"
PageScraper_MatchData10="MatchName:Match10","OccurRangeBegin:1"
PageScraper_MatchData11="MatchName:Match11","OccurRangeBegin:1"
PageScraper_MatchData12="MatchName:Match12","OccurRangeBegin:1"
PageScraper_MatchData13="MatchName:Match13","OccurRangeBegin:1"
PageScraper_MatchData14="MatchName:Match14","OccurRangeBegin:1"
PageScraper_MatchData15="MatchName:Match15","OccurRangeBegin:1"
PageScraper_MatchData16="MatchName:Match16","OccurRangeBegin:1"
PageScraper_MatchData17="MatchName:Match17","OccurRangeBegin:1"
PageScraper_MatchData18="MatchName:Match18","OccurRangeBegin:1"
PageScraper_MatchData19="MatchName:Match19","OccurRangeBegin:1"
PageScraper_MatchData20="MatchName:Match20","OccurRangeBegin:1"
PageScraper_MatchData21="MatchName:Match21","OccurRangeBegin:1"
PageScraper_MatchData22="MatchName:Match22","OccurRangeBegin:1"
PageScraper_MatchData23="MatchName:Match23","OccurRangeBegin:1"
PageScraper_MatchData24="MatchName:Match24","OccurRangeBegin:1"
PageScraper_MatchData25="MatchName:Match25","OccurRangeBegin:1"

[Output 56]
Type=TTextOutput
Text=G
Color=FF000000
Align=0
AlignVertical=0
FontName=Tahoma
FontSize=14
FontStyle=[fsBold]
FontCharset=1
LineSpacing=1
NrOfDecimals=0
TabSize=20
TruncateText=0
AlwaysTruncateRight=0
WordWrap=0
Antialiased=1
ForceAntialiased=0
UseSeperators=0
Scroll=0
ScrollInterval=1000
ScrollPause=0
ScrollPauseInterval=1000
ScrollSeperator=%sp|%sp
ScrollDirection=0
ScrollType=0
ScrollVerticalOffset=1
MinDigitsBeforeDP=0
TextShadow=0
TextShadowXOffset=1
TextShadowYOffset=1
TextShadowColor=FF000000
Left=1817
Top=13
Right=1821
Bottom=18
UpdateInterval=0
AllowAlertValue=1
NumberOfAlertValues=0
AllowMaths=0
AddBackground=0
Background=00000000
AddBorder=0
BorderColor=FF000000
BorderWidth=1
Grid=0
GridColor=FF000000
GridX=10
GridY=10
ShadowXOffset=0
ShadowYOffset=0
ShadowColor=00000000
DoShadow=0

[InputController 56]
AllowInput=0

[Meter 57]
Name=Copy 9 of Meter 49
Group=
Locking=0

[Source 57]
Type=TActiveDLLCollector
DLLName=PageScraper.dll
DLLFunction=GetWebpage
PageScraper_Webpage="http://www.xxxxx.de/xxxxx/xxxxx2.txt"
PageScraper_PageScraperName="PageScraper1"
PageScraper_Seconds=6000
PageScraper_SaveINIFile=1
PageScraper_SaveINIFilename="%SAMDIR%\plugins\PageScraper\dm_bc.ini"
PageScraper_SaveTMPFilename="%SAMDIR%\plugins\PageScraper\.tmp"
PageScraper_MatchData1="Match:1","MatchName:Match1","MatchStart:xxxxx ","MatchEnd:DB","OccurRangeBegin:1","ModifyEnabled1:1","ModifyType1:RightTrim","ModifyFirstStr1:%b"
PageScraper_MatchData2="Match:1","MatchName:Match2","MatchStart:xxxxx ","MatchEnd:DB","OccurRangeBegin:1","ModifyEnabled1:1","ModifyType1:RightTrim","ModifyFirstStr1:%b"
PageScraper_MatchData3="Match:1","MatchName:Match3","MatchStart:xxxxx ","MatchEnd:FTP","OccurRangeBegin:1","ModifyEnabled1:1","ModifyType1:RightTrim","ModifyFirstStr1:%b"
PageScraper_MatchData4="Match:1","MatchName:Match4","MatchStart:xxxxx ","MatchEnd:FTP","OccurRangeBegin:1","ModifyEnabled1:1","ModifyType1:RightTrim","ModifyFirstStr1:%b"
PageScraper_MatchData5="Match:1","MatchName:Match5","MatchStart:xxxxx ","MatchEnd:FTP","OccurRangeBegin:1","ModifyEnabled1:1","ModifyType1:RightTrim","ModifyFirstStr1:%b"
PageScraper_MatchData6="Match:1","MatchName:Match6","MatchStart:xxxxx ","OccurRangeBegin:1","ModifyEnabled1:1","ModifyType1:Filter"
PageScraper_MatchData7="MatchName:Match7","OccurRangeBegin:1"
PageScraper_MatchData8="MatchName:Match8","OccurRangeBegin:1"
PageScraper_MatchData9="MatchName:Match9","OccurRangeBegin:1"
PageScraper_MatchData10="MatchName:Match10","OccurRangeBegin:1"
PageScraper_MatchData11="MatchName:Match11","OccurRangeBegin:1"
PageScraper_MatchData12="MatchName:Match12","OccurRangeBegin:1"
PageScraper_MatchData13="MatchName:Match13","OccurRangeBegin:1"
PageScraper_MatchData14="MatchName:Match14","OccurRangeBegin:1"
PageScraper_MatchData15="MatchName:Match15","OccurRangeBegin:1"
PageScraper_MatchData16="MatchName:Match16","OccurRangeBegin:1"
PageScraper_MatchData17="MatchName:Match17","OccurRangeBegin:1"
PageScraper_MatchData18="MatchName:Match18","OccurRangeBegin:1"
PageScraper_MatchData19="MatchName:Match19","OccurRangeBegin:1"
PageScraper_MatchData20="MatchName:Match20","OccurRangeBegin:1"
PageScraper_MatchData21="MatchName:Match21","OccurRangeBegin:1"
PageScraper_MatchData22="MatchName:Match22","OccurRangeBegin:1"
PageScraper_MatchData23="MatchName:Match23","OccurRangeBegin:1"
PageScraper_MatchData24="MatchName:Match24","OccurRangeBegin:1"
PageScraper_MatchData25="MatchName:Match25","OccurRangeBegin:1"

[Output 57]
Type=TTextOutput
Text=DM
Color=FF000000
Align=0
AlignVertical=0
FontName=Tahoma
FontSize=14
FontStyle=[fsBold]
FontCharset=1
LineSpacing=1
NrOfDecimals=0
TabSize=20
TruncateText=0
AlwaysTruncateRight=0
WordWrap=0
Antialiased=1
ForceAntialiased=0
UseSeperators=0
Scroll=0
ScrollInterval=1000
ScrollPause=0
ScrollPauseInterval=1000
ScrollSeperator=%sp|%sp
ScrollDirection=0
ScrollType=0
ScrollVerticalOffset=1
MinDigitsBeforeDP=0
TextShadow=0
TextShadowXOffset=1
TextShadowYOffset=1
TextShadowColor=FF000000
Left=1817
Top=21
Right=1821
Bottom=26
UpdateInterval=0
AllowAlertValue=1
NumberOfAlertValues=0
AllowMaths=0
AddBackground=0
Background=00000000
AddBorder=0
BorderColor=FF000000
BorderWidth=1
Grid=0
GridColor=FF000000
GridX=10
GridY=10
ShadowXOffset=0
ShadowYOffset=0
ShadowColor=00000000
DoShadow=0

[InputController 57]
AllowInput=0

[PluginInfo]
PageScraper_Version=3.0.2 - July 04 2010
Kann jemand ev. eine config vom 3er PageScraper posten als Vergleich? danke.

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 16:35
von Schnuffel
Info für die 2.9

- removed support for configs that were saved prior to v2.60 (April 2008). any old configs that use %Match instead of [Match] will need to resaved before using future builds of the plugin.
Tja, das schaut nach ein wenig Arbeit für dich aus...

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 20.11.2011, 16:51
von Gumfuzi
danke, das war's:
"nur" die ganzen "Match"1-25 mit eckigen Klammern versehen

Vielen Dank, Schnuffel!!!

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 21.11.2013, 17:21
von RoYmA
Hi um nicht extra einen neuen Thread zu öffnen klinke ich mich hier mal ein.

Meine config exe lässt sich auch nicht öffnen. Aber erst nach dem ich bei euch im Download bereich die SAM- Machine gedownloadet habe

Wenn ich eine ini bearbeiten möchte, öffnet sie nicht richtig, sondern nur im Task-Manager. Ich habe auch schon Samu deinstalliert und neu runtergeladen
aber hat nichts geholfen...


Danke schon mal für eure Aufmerksamkeit

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 21.11.2013, 18:11
von moinmoin
Du meinst das hier? http://www.deskmodder.de/phpBB3/viewtop ... ne#p203336

Ist schwierig zu sagen was da schief läuft. Hast du die Config denn mal nach bzw. vor der Deinstallation entfernt?

Re: "Config.exe funktioniert nicht mehr"

Verfasst: 21.11.2013, 18:32
von RoYmA
Ja genau die!

und ja, habe alles so weit ich weiß von Machine vorher gelöscht
Ich wollte mir eigentlich die configslider.dll da raus holen